Hypnosis Settlement

The principal seems to have been trying to help students (and staff member) deal with various psychological problems through hypnosis, and delivered his services to “at least 75 people at the school.” The students died through suicide (in 2 cases, both by hanging) and a car accident (in which the young man reportedly had “a strange look on his face” before going off the interstate).

I can’t figure out what the cause and effect was, but the school district chose to pay rather than to fight over it.
